Date palms can take 4 to 8 years after planting before they will bear fruit, and start producing viable yields for commercial harvest between 7 and 10 years. Mature date palms can produce 70–140 kilograms (150–300 pounds) [21] [22] of dates per harvest season. They do not all ripen at the same time so several harvests are required.
